Keeping the routine - morning walks
Both start from the Airbnb door (right by Wicked Weed on Biltmore Ave) and land in the 30-45 min range. Downtown is genuinely hilly, so even the flatter route earns the coffee after.
1 · Urban Trail loop~2 mi · ~40 min
Walk north on Biltmore Ave ~3 min to Pack Square Park, then follow the self-guided Asheville Urban Trail - a 1.7 mi loop past ~30 public-art stations, out toward Eagle Street, and back to the square down Biltmore to your door. Scenic, leaves from the doorstep, lands almost exactly in range.
For laps or intervals: Memorial Stadium (30 Buchanan Ave) has a 6-lane synthetic track open for public rec use - a ~15 min walk SE past Mission Hospital (those hills are your warm-up). Four laps = 1 mile. Walk over, run your laps, walk back fills 30-45 min easily.
Track access can close for events or team practice - worth a quick check it is open the morning of, with the Urban Trail as backup.
